Erbil, Kurdistan Region, Iraq (gov.krd) – Kurdistan Regional Government Prime Minister, Nechrivan Barzani, heading a KRG delegation, arrived in Dubai yesterday for an official visit.

The Kurdistan Regional Government was invited by United Arab Emirates to attend the 2015 Dubai Government Summit, where over 100 global speakers, including United Nations Secretary General, Ban Ki-moon and a number of international institutions representatives are expected to attend the event.

The Summit will discuss a number of issues related to good governance, public administration and their development. It is scheduled to last three days, where several meetings are expected to be held on the sidelines of this Summit.

The KRG delegation, which includes Deputy Prime Minister, Qubad Talabani, Minister of Natural Resources, Ashti Hawrami, Minister of Planning, Ali Sindi, Minister of Finance and Economy, Rebaz Mohammad and KRG spokesperson, Minister Safeen Dizayee, is scheduled to hold a number of meetings with senior UAE officials during this visit.

Dubai, United Arab Emirates (gov.krd) – The Kurdistan Regional Government’s Prime Minister, Nechirvan Barzani, accompanied by a KRG senior delegation, yesterday attended the opening ceremony of the 2015 Dubai Government Summit.

It was also attended by the United Nations Secretary General, Ban Ki-moon,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al-Maktoum, Vice President and Prime Minister of the United Arab Emirates and Ruler of Dubai,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ed Al-Nahyan, Crown Prince of Abu Dhabi and Deputy Supreme Commander of the UAE Armed Forces as well as representatives of 93 countries which included heads of states and senior leaders of international organisations.

Prime Minister Barzani and his accompanying delegation arrived Dubai on Sunday evening. The Kurdistan Regional Government was officially invited by the United Arab Emirates Government to attend the summit. The Kurdistan Regional Government delegation included Deputy Prime Minister, Qubad Talabani, Minister of Natural Resources, Ashti Hawrami, Minister of Planning, Ali Sindi, Minister of Finance and Economy, Rebaz Mohammad and KRG spokesperson, Minister Safeen Dizayee. The delegation is expected to conduct a number of important meetings with the United Arab Emirates senior officials.

The Dubai Government Summit is considered the second largest summit in the world, involving over four thousand people representing 93 countries. The summit will host a number of lectures, seminars, dialogue sessions aimed at improving the way governments work in future, including the development of e-governance, planning and forecasting for future government as well as a number of other topics related to improving governance.

Dubai, United Arab Emirates (gov.krg) - On the second day of the Kurdistan Regional Government delegation’s official visit to the United Arab Emirates, Kurdistan Region Prime Minister, Nechirvan Barzani and his accompanying delegation were received yesterday by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al-Maktoum, Vice-President and Prime Minister of the UAE and Ruler of Dubai.

The two sides discussed bilateral relations between the Kurdistan Region and United Arab Emirates. They reaffirmed their willingness to develop these relations, particularly in the political and economic domains.

The latest developments in the region and the war against the Islamic State terrorist organisation, ISIS, were discussed in the meeting. The two sides stressed the importance of the role of the international coalition in the war against terrorism.

Prime Minister Barzani and his accompanying delegation arrived Dubai on Sunday on an official invitation by UAE government to attend 2015 Dubai Government Summit. The KRG delegation included Deputy Prime Minister, Qubad Talabani, Minister of Natural Resources, Ashti Hawrami, Minister of Planning, Ali Sindi, Minister of Finance and Economy, Rebaz Muhammad and KRG spokesperson, Minister Safeen Dizayee.

Erbil, Kurdistan Region, Iraq (dfr.krg.org) – Today the President’s Chief of Staff, Dr Fuad Hussein, the Head of KRG Department of Foreign Relations, Minister Falah Mustafa, and the Head of KRG Department of Media and Information, Minister Safeen Dizayee briefed diplomats and representatives of international organizations on the latest developments.

Minister Mustafa thanked diplomats and representatives of international organizations for their attendance and gave an overview of the recent agreement between Erbil and Baghdad, the fight against Islamic State of Iraq and al-Sham (ISIS), as well as humanitarian and financial challenges facing the Kurdistan Region.

“We have always preferred to resolve our disputes with Baghdad through dialogue and negotiation. The recently reached agreement is a temporary agreement but we consider it a good start. It is in the interests of both Erbil and Baghdad. We are committed to continue our cooperation with Baghdad in order to finalize more lasting agreements on all of outstanding issues between Erbil and Baghdad,” Minister Mustafa commented on the agreement. 

Minister Dizayee, who was a member of the KRG delegation to Baghdad, said “The atmosphere of the meeting was very positive. Both sides were determined to reach a mutually beneficial agreement and we saw real desire by Prime Minister Abadi and member of his cabinet to resolve outstanding issues with Erbil.”

Highlighting the advances of Kurdistan’s Peshmerga forces against the ISIS terrorists, Minister Mustafa said, “Thanks to the support of our coalition partners that have provided our forces with military equipments, weapons, and training, and thanks to the bravery of our Peshmerga forces, we have managed to regain control of the vast majority of territory that had been occupied by the ISIS in early August.”

Dr. Hussein emphasized, “Achieving greater security success and stability in Iraq will largely depend on progress in the political process. A genuine power sharing among the Kurds, Shiites, and Sunnis is the only possible way forward.” 

Minister Mustafa also updated the attendants on the latest humanitarian developments and the needs of refugees and internally displaced persons who have taken refuge in the Kurdistan Region. He added, “KRG has made concerted efforts to alleviate the sufferings of refugees and IDPs but with our limited resources we are unable to provide adequate relief and assistance.”

Referring to the impact of financial and security challenges on the economic process in the Kurdistan Region during the past several months, Minster Mustafa said, “Today, with the new agreement in hand for revenue sharing and energy, and with steady progress against ISIS, we look with optimism to the period ahead.”

During the meeting, Dr Hussein and Minister Dizayee provided more details on the recent agreement between Erbil and Baghdad as well as the security and economic cooperation between both sides in the face of current challenges.

Consul General of the Hashemite Kingdom of Jordan, Fayiz F. Khouri, the new Dean of the diplomatic corps, thanked the DFR for arranging the meeting and expressed his gratitude for the comprehensive briefing on behalf of the diplomats. During the meeting, diplomats and representatives exchanged thoughts on the recent developments. They commended KRG for sheltering hundreds of thousands of refugees and IDPs and highly praised the role of Peshmerga forces in the fight against ISIS terrorists.

The meeting was attended by diplomats from Jordan, Palestine, United Arab Emirates, United States of America, Turkey, Poland, United Kingdom, China, Germany, Russia, Hungary, Egypt, Italy, Romania, The Netherlands, South Korea, Czech Republic, Iran, France, Bulgaria, Japan, UNAMI.
